ADT - libstdС++. So.6: невозможно открыть файл общих объектов
У меня 64-разрядная версия Fedora 20, и у меня проблема с Android Development Tools.
Когда я пытаюсь запустить проект, у меня есть следующие ошибки:
[2014-05-11 22:08:03 - TestAp] /home/damian/adt-bundle-linux-x86_64-20140321/sdk/build-tools/android-4.4.2/aapt:
error while loading shared libraries: libstdc++.so.6: cannot open
shared object file: No such file or directory
[2014-05-11 22:08:03 - appcompat_v7] /home/damian/adt-bundle-linux-x86_64-20140321/sdk/build-tools/android-4.4.2/aapt:
error while loading shared libraries: libstdc++.so.6: cannot open
shared object file: No such file or directory
Я знаю, что мой вопрос также здесь, но решения не работают с Fedora 20.
Ответы
Ответ 1
Я не совсем уверен в Fedora 20, но у меня была такая же проблема в Ubuntu 14.04 и установка этих библиотек исправила ее.
sudo apt-get install lib32stdc++6 lib32z1 lib32z1-dev
Смотрите это сообщение:
Android SDK - ошибка aapt: libstdС++. so.6 не может открыть файл общих объектов
Ответ 2
При установке NDK на RedHat x64 эти команды были полезны для меня:
yum update
yum install libstdc++.i686
yum install compat-libstdc++-33.i686
Os:
[[email protected] ~]# cat /etc/redhat-release
CentOS release 6.6 (Final)